6 weeks! This week the pups have done a lot. They are learning how to walk on leashes, potty outside, how to play with other dogs, how to sit to say please, how to climb up the front steps, and so much more. We’ve also started taking them on more car rides and out places with us when we can. We can’t cover everything needed to socialize these babes, but we do try to cover a lot. Hip Dysplasia
Hip testing reduces the chance of passing down hip dysplasia, which is primarily found in large breed dogs and can cause hip pain and the eventual loss of the function of the hip joint.

DNA Disease Panel, Degenerative Myelopathy (DM; SOD1A), PRA, Rod-Cone Degeneration (PRA-prcd), Neonatal Encephalopathy with Seizures (NEwS), von Willebrand Disease I (vWD I), PRA, Golden Retriever 2, PRA, Golden Retriever 1
Genetic testing reduces the chance of passing down a wide variety of hereditary diseases of differing prevalence and severity such as Progressive Retinal Atrophy (an eye disease) and Von Willebrand's Disease (a blood disease).
